Description of position:
Safety and Security
Ensure that Business Unit adhere to prescribed Regulatory Stipulations such as OHS, Safety and Security, company policies and procedure
Management and Maintenance of Safety and Security of all Cargo, Equipment and Staff
Access and Egress Control
Adhere to PPE requirements of Personnel
Identify and be aware of potential risks that may affect normal operations.
Customer and Supplier Service
Accountable for management of customer/supplier service level agreements
Management of statutory requirements and relationships with state, semi state and privatized businesses that may have an impact on the company
Maintaining open and frequent channels of communication with other branched / divisions within the company within your sphere of responsibility
HR / IR
Management of staff reporting to him/her
Managing staff expectations in respect of discipline and motivation
Managing operational processes and ensuring all staff have access to policies and procedures of the company
Ensure staff adhere to code of conduct and disciplinary processes and procedures
Initiation or chairing of a hearing if and when required.
Admin
Accountable for overall administration functions of this division such as daily KPI reports, submission of overtime schedules, and discrepancy reports
Manage overall expenses to the company and ensuring cost saving
Training
Manage and ensure that staff training is done at the right time and that the necessary training has been done whether mandatory or soft skills.
Operational Requirements
To adhere to all of company policies, procedures and SHE requirements.
Direct and coordinates the company’s operation functions.
Analyse all aspects of logistics to determine the most cost-effective and efficient means of transporting products and supplies.
Direct inbound and outbound logistics operation, such as transportation or warehouse activities, safety performance, and quality management.
Analyse the financial impact of proposed logistics changes, such as routing, shipping modes, product volumes and mixes, and carriers ect.
Assist in developing and managing the operations budgets.
Participate in the development of new project proposals.
Establish and implement short- and long-range goals, objectives, policies, and operating procedures.
Promotes positive relations with partners, vendors, and distributors.
Recommend and administer policies and procedures to enhance operations.
Work with the department managers and coordinate staff to execute five year and ten year business plans for the company.
Recruit, train, supervise, and evaluate department staff.
Supervise and manage the work of operation personnel.
Collaborate with the other departments to integrate logistics with the business systems and processes, such as accounting and HR.
Responsible for handling all of operations related HR issues.
Design models for use in evaluating logistics programs and services.
Identify and eliminates risk factors that can influence operation.
Other duties as assigned.

REQUIREMENTS
Essential Criteria:
Matric
Tertiary Qualification in Logistics / Supply Chain beneficial
Cross Border road freight experience.
Minimum of 5 years’ experience in the transport industry, with at least 2 years in operations management position.
Essential to have vast hand on experience in the loading and off-loading of break bulk goods on vehicle ranging from 1 Ton to interlinks.
Materials Handling experience i.e. forklift, tie down and Hazchem operations
Management of staff
Competent in MS Office
Thorough knowledge of HR/IR functions
Report Writing
Ability to motivate teams to produce quality materials within tight timeframe and simultaneously manage several projects .
Ability to participate in and facilitate group meetings.
Work requires willingness to work a flexible schedule.
Liaise and attend meetings with other company functions necessary to perform duties and aid business and organisational developments.
Attend training and to develop relevant knowledge skills.
Ability to work alone and self-motivated.
Team player.
Competencies required:
Strong interpersonal and business communication skills, written and verbal.
Strong Leadership qualities and conflict resolution abilities
Lateral Thinking
Ability to work in a pressurized environment.
Superior planning and execution skills.
Negotiator
